What is Japanese Investment in the World Economy about?
As The Title Suggests, This Is An Ambitious Book. Broad In Scope And Rich In Detail, It Examines The Rise And Fall Of Japanese Foreign Direct Investment (fdi) In Nearly Two Dozen Industries, From Electronics And Automobile Manufacturing To Real Estate And Construction Services, In Almost Every Region Of The World Over The Past Half Century Or More. The Result Is An Encyclopedic Volume (459 Pages With Index). . . Useful For East Asian Business Scholars Or Those Interested In The Overseas Activities Of Japanese Firms. Farrell Has Written. . . A Sweeping Survey Of Japanese Fdi. Walter Hatch, Journal Of Japanese Studies Roger Farrell Has Written A Weighty Compendium On Japanese Direct Foreign Investment. At Over 450 Pages It Covers The Full Array Of Japan S Diverse Industries And Sectors, From Fisheries And Lumber To Steel And Automobiles, And In The Service Industries From Banking To Telecommunications. Apart From The Breadth Of Coverage, This Work Is Even More Remarkable Considering That Japanese Multinationals And Their Overseas Investments Have Been Largely Under The Radar Of Social Scientists Of Late, Especially So Since The Ascent Of China In The Early Years Of The Present Decade
